Terra Nitrogen Company, L.P. Reports First Quarter
2016 Results

DEERFIELD, IL (May 4, 2016)—Terra Nitrogen Company, L.P. (TNCLP) (NYSE: TNH) today reported net earnings of $37.7 million on net sales of $108.0 million for the quarter ended March 31, 2016. This compares to net earnings of $59.0 million on net sales of $126.6 million for the 2015 first quarter. Net earnings allocable to common units was $26.7 million ($1.44 per common unit) and $37.5 million ($2.03 per common unit) for the 2016 and 2015 first quarters, respectively. Results for the first quarter of 2016 included an unrealized net mark-to-market loss on natural gas derivatives of $2.3 million compared to a gain of $3.9 million in the first quarter of 2015. The derivative portfolio at March 31, 2016 includes natural gas derivatives that hedge a portion of 2016, 2017 and 2018 natural gas purchases.

Analysis of Results

Net sales for the first quarter of 2016 totaled $108.0 million, compared to $126.6 million for the first quarter of 2015, with lower realized selling prices for ammonia and UAN and decreased sales volumes of ammonia partially offset by increased sales volumes of UAN. Ammonia and UAN selling prices were lower in the first quarter of 2016 due to greater nitrogen supply driven by global capacity additions, coupled with lower manufacturing and ocean freight costs, and softer global ammonia demand from industrial users including phosphate fertilizer production. UAN sales volume increased 17 percent and ammonia sales volume decreased 4 percent in the first quarter of 2016 compared to the first quarter of 2015. The increase in UAN sales volumes was driven by greater supply availability in the current quarter compared to the prior year's period. The increase in availability resulted from a higher inventory entering the first quarter of 2016, as well as higher UAN production in the first quarter of 2016 compared to the first quarter of 2015.

In the first quarter of 2016, the company experienced an unscheduled outage for maintenance on one of the facility’s two ammonia plants, resulting in one-half of the complex's ammonia capacity being shut down for approximately two months, and one-half of the complex's UAN capacity being shut down for approximately one month. Maintenance was completed and the affected ammonia plant was restarted on March 17, 2016. In the first quarter of 2015, the company had a planned turnaround of an ammonia plant and a UAN plant, together representing approximately one-half of the company's production capacity. The plants were both shut down for a period of approximately two months during the first quarter of 2015.

Comparing the first quarter of 2016 to 2015, TNCLP’s:
Ammonia average selling prices decreased by 25 percent and UAN average selling prices decreased by 20 percent;
Ammonia sales volume decreased by 4 percent and UAN sales volume increased by 17 percent; and
Realized natural gas cost per MMBtu decreased by 18 percent.

Cash Distribution
Cash distributions depend on TNCLP’s earnings as well as cash requirements for working capital needs and capital expenditures. In the first quarter of 2016, capital expenditures were $13.8 million as compared to $47.8 million in 2015, with the decrease primarily due to the large plant turnaround activities in 2015 that did not recur in 2016. For the full year 2016, TNCLP is expected to have capital expenditures in the range of $45 million to $55 million.

TNCLP reported on May 4, 2016, the declaration of a cash distribution for the quarter ended March 31, 2016, of $1.51 per common unit payable May 31, 2016 to holders of record as of May 16, 2016.

Cash distributions per common unit also vary based on increasing amounts allocable to the General Partner when cumulative distributions exceed targeted levels. With this distribution, TNCLP cumulative distributions continue to exceed targeted levels.

About TNCLP
Terra Nitrogen Company, L.P. is a leading manufacturer of nitrogen fertilizer products.

TNCLP is the sole limited partner of Terra Nitrogen, Limited Partnership (TNLP), owner of the Verdigris, Oklahoma manufacturing facility and related assets. Terra Nitrogen GP Inc., an indirect, wholly-owned subsidiary of CF Industries Holdings, Inc., is the General Partner of TNCLP and exercises full control over all of TNCLP’s business affairs.
